What is a Lean-To Conservatory?
A lean-to conservatory, also called a sunroom or garden room, is generally defined by a rectangular shape that leans versus an existing wall of the home. This type of conservatory has an inclined roofing system, which permits sufficient natural light and develops an inviting environment. It is particularly well-suited for smaller residential or commercial properties or homes with restricted garden area.

The setup of a lean-to conservatory includes numerous steps. Below is a detailed outline of the process:
StepDescription1. Preparation and DesignTalk to a design specialist to develop a strategy that meets your requirements and adhere to local regulations. Consider the integration with existing architecture and landscaping.2. Site PreparationClear the location where the conservatory will be set up. Guarantee that the ground is level and suitable for building.3. StructuresLay a strong foundation that will support the weight of the Conservatory Builders Near Me. This typically includes digging trenches and pouring concrete.4. Structure InstallationBuild the framework using products like uPVC, aluminum, or wood. This structure will offer the structural integrity of the conservatory.5. Glazing InstallationInstall glass panels for walls and roofing, guaranteeing they are firmly sealed and insulated. Pick double or triple glazing for optimal energy effectiveness.6. Completing TouchesAdd doors, flooring, electrical fittings, and decoration to finish the appearance and functionality of the conservatory.7. Final InspectionConduct a thorough inspection to guarantee everything depends on code and practical before utilizing the space.Factors to Consider

1. Do I need planning permission for a Lean-To Conservatory Conversion conservatory?Planning approval requirements vary by area. In most cases, lean-to conservatories fall under permitted development rights, however it's always best to validate with your local council.

2. How long does it take to set up a lean-to conservatory?Setup usually takes 4 to 8 weeks, depending upon the complexity of the style and weather condition conditions.

3. What is the cost of a lean-to conservatory?The cost can vary commonly based upon size, products, and features however typically varies from ₤ 10,000 to ₤ 25,000.

4. Exist any upkeep requirements for a lean-to conservatory?Regular upkeep consists of cleaning the glass panels, checking seals, and making sure seamless gutters and drain are clear. If wood frames are utilized, regular painting or treatment may be essential.

5. Can I use my lean-to conservatory year-round?With correct insulation and heating, a lean-to conservatory can be taken pleasure in year-round.
